The
Model tab comprises a set of tools as detailed
below:
- GC Attributes - Used to manage node visibility status, assign symbology.
- Primary - Contains a wide variety of GC tools that are commonly used. Tools in this group can also be found in other group with other related tools on the Model ribbon.
- Selection - Contains tools for selecting single or multiple elements or to define a Construction Plane.
- Place Geometry - Used to create basic nodes and promote elements. Nodes, such as points, planes, and coordinate systems or to create a complex node such as lines, polylines, polygon, and BSplineCurve can be created quickly.
- Manipulate - Used to move, duplicate or mirror copy nodes, as well as differ dynamics in moving nodes or differ update graph.
- Modify - Used to edit nodes, split or combine points, switch supports and to delete submodel.
- Tools and Controls - Used to update the model and manage the nodes using the control interfaces.
- Calculations - Used to create functions, call functions and values via graph nodes, and to define operations.
- Data - Used to access the Console and Watches dialogs.
- Transactions - Used to display, record, delete, and display transactions including those affected.
- Packages - Used to manage node types, GC packages, for assigning namespaces, and loading external DLL assemblies.
